Crosby, Malkin, and Ovechkin all had 110 point seasons by the time they were 21. I think people forget just how dominant they were at a very young age. That's why they were the big three. Stamkos is close, but misses IMO. Giroux is not really that close in my mind. Amazing player and top player in the league, but not close to what the big three were.
